Intel and Wind River At It Again

By AndroidGuys • Jun 5th, 2008 • Category: Open Handset Alliance News, Recent News, Related News

Intel and Wind River entered into an agreement on Thursday to collaborate in the development of a Linux platform to be used in Mobile Internet Devices or MIDs.  These MIDs would be optimized to run on Intel’s Centrino Atom processor and is expected to be available some time in 2009 according to an article on […]
